Output 66100638637a3473e3a3cd3083761cfff94053f19ff4e364f3850e2c16f27ca1:14

value
25511022
script pubkey
OP_0 OP_PUSHBYTES_20 abcd6a6a6c940e58801a1b25759cd65d45642f3e
address
bc1q40xk56nvjs893qq6rvjht8xkt4zkgte7v7xzxr
transaction
66100638637a3473e3a3cd3083761cfff94053f19ff4e364f3850e2c16f27ca1
confirmations
31468
spent
true